    Tomatin 12 Year Old Bourbon & Sherry Casks

    In 2014, the Tomatin 12 Year Old was given an update and bottled at 43% ABV rather 40%, as it was previously. This core single malt from the ace distillery in the Highlands is finished for six-to-nine months in Oloroso Sherry casks before being bottled.

    Tasting Note by The Chaps at Master of Malt

    Nose

    Buttery at first, but notes of cooked apple, raisin and almond soon emerge. There are resinous and floral hints as well as some chocolate.

    Palate

    Oak-y vanilla and fresh mint, dotted with stem ginger, a touch of guava and dried orange peel.

    Finish

    Currant buns, a hint of raspberry jam, barley.
